Experience the delightful July weather in Calvia, Spain, where temperatures soar to a maximum of 30°C (87°F) and hover around a pleasant average of 25°C (78°F). Enjoy the balmy evenings with a minimum temperature of 21°C (69°F), perfect for dining al fresco by the shores. This month boasts an almost imperceptible precipitation level of just 2 mm (0.1 in), with zero rainy days, allowing for uninterrupted enjoyment of the dazzling Mediterranean sun. With humidity at 79%, the warmth is balanced by the refreshing sea breeze, making July an ideal time to soak in the beauty and vibrancy of this coastal paradise.

In July, Calvià, Spain, basks in the height of summer with an impressive precipitation total of just 2 mm (0.1 in), making it one of the driest months of the year. This low rainfall is reflected in the weather patterns, as there are no recorded precipitation days, allowing residents and visitors to fully enjoy the sun-drenched beaches and vibrant outdoor activities. Following June's modest 16 mm over just 2 days, July's stark dryness marks a notable shift, effectively heralding the peak tourist season. As summer transitions into August, a slight increase in precipitation to 10 mm (0.4 in) suggests that while July is a drought-like oasis, the region prepares itself for the occasional summer shower. July in Calvia, Spain, sees a UV Index of 10, placing it firmly in the very high exposure category. This indicates a slight decrease from June's intense UV Index of 11, which pushed for an even shorter burn time of just 10 minutes. In contrast, July’s burn time extends to 15 minutes, yet caution is still essential as the sun's rays remain potent. The trend from spring through summer highlights a significant increase in UV intensity, with values rising from a moderate 3 in January to this peak in July. In Calvia, Spain, July shines brightly, boasting an impressive 422 hours of sunshine, making it the sunniest month of the year. As summer hits its peak, the days are longer, allowing visitors to bask in the warm glow of the Mediterranean sun. This month sits at the pinnacle of a steady increase in sunshine hours that begins in January with just 212 hours. Following the upward trend, the sunshine hours steadily rise each month, culminating in July's vibrant afternoons, before dipping slightly in August.
